What is the primary advantage of using a submersible pump over a jet pump in deep well applications?

AHigher efficiency due to direct water contact

BReduced risk of cavitation

CBetter suitability for shallow wells

DLower initial cost

Answer:

A. Higher efficiency due to direct water contact

Read Explanation:

The primary advantage of using a submersible pump over a jet pump in deep well applications is higher efficiency due to direct water contact. Submersible pumps are placed directly in the water, which allows them to push water to the surface more efficiently than jet pumps, which have to pull water up, leading to energy losses and reduced efficiency.
